## Tenant hitting 429s despite low traffic

Per-tenant quotas in Quotaleaf are enforced per region, not globally. A tenant routed across two regions can exhaust one region's bucket while the other sits idle. Check the tenant's routing policy first, then their quota tier.

To inspect live bucket counters, query the quota service with the support bearer token below.

session JWT of yawep-yawep = eyJhbGciOiJIUzI1NiIsInR5cCI6IkpXVCJ9.eyJzdWIiOiI3pWF3_In0.aXYsHiog

Subject: CSV Import Wizard cut-over — done

Team,

Cut-over to the new Marrowfield import wizard finished Tuesday night. Legacy uploader is dark; redirects in place. Throughput is up, rejects are down, and the Pellworth batch ran clean. One straggler: delimiter auto-detect misfires on semicolon files, patch lands Friday. The wizard now runs with the following configuration values.

config for bagep-kageg:
ULADOR_LOG_LEVEL=warn
ULADOR_METRICS_HOST=metrics.ulador.tolvaqcorp.corp
ULADOR_POOL_SIZE=32

Heads up: this alert fires when Pagewright's incremental rebuild queue backs up for more than ten minutes. Usually it just means someone pushed a huge content batch, but it can also signal a stuck worker. Don't panic — most of these clear themselves. The triage steps live on our internal wiki page.

operations page: https://jenkins.zemvarcloud.local/job/merge_requests/repo/build/73930b4b30f0a8ed